Procedural Posture

Miscellaneous Application / Ruling on Notice of Motion for Eviction and Enforcement of Decree

  1. 1 Whether the applicants are entitled to enforcement of the decree and eviction of the respondent from Plot No. GSA/24 (Garissa Township Block 1/17).
  2. 2 Whether the respondent's continued occupation is unlawful and warrants compensation to the applicants.
  3. 3 Whether the court should grant police assistance for enforcement of the eviction order.

Ratio Decidendi

The court found that the applicants were entitled to enforce the decree issued in their favor following the dismissal of the respondent's suit in 2009. The respondent, having been served with the decree and subsequent notice to vacate, failed to comply and remained in unlawful occupation of the suit property. The court emphasized the necessity of upholding judicial authority and the rule of law by ensuring compliance with court orders. The absence of any response or opposition from the respondent further strengthened the applicants' case. The court concluded that the applicants had demonstrated sufficient grounds for eviction, enforcement of the decree, and provision of police assistance...

Court Disposition

application allowed as prayed with costs to the applicants

Orders

  • The respondent, Abdalla Mohamed Omar, is ordered to vacate Plot No. GSA/24 (Garissa Township Block 1/17).
  • An eviction order is issued authorizing the Court Bailiff, Garissa Law Courts, to remove the respondent from the suit land.
